Why Model Matters More Than You Might Think

Let's kick things off with something essential: the specific model of your UAS. Now, you might think it’s all about flying high and capturing the perfect shot, but every drone comes with its own set of capabilities. Some models can handle high winds and varied terrains, while others are more limited. This difference can significantly impact where you can operate your aircraft.

Imagine riding a sports car versus a sturdy SUV. While the sports car screams down the smooth highway like a bolt of lightning, the SUV confidently tackles rough roads and steep hills. Similarly, understanding the capabilities of your drone can mean the difference between a successful flight and a potentially risky situation. So, always check your model’s specifications before planning your drone operations. It's like reading the map before hitting the road—smart thinking!

Geographical Location: The Where of Your Operations

Next up is geographical location. This is a crucial factor you can’t overlook. The airspace above us isn’t just an empty canvas; there are regulations in play that can limit where you can fly your drone. Some areas, close to airports or military installations, may have restrictions that prevent you from operating your UAS there.

Think about it this way: Picture your neighborhood as a massive puzzle with various shapes and sizes. Some pieces—like your home or local parks—fit perfectly for drone flying, while others—think school zones or near busy roadways—might end up being no-fly zones. It’s all about playing by the rules and knowing the lay of the land. Every pilot, without exception, must understand local laws to ensure both safety and compliance.

Weather or Not?

Environmental conditions also play a significant role in determining operational zones. What good is a great drone if you can’t fly it due to bad weather? High winds, rain, or extreme temperatures can affect how your drone performs. Just imagine trying to have a picnic during a thunderstorm—it's simply not going to be enjoyable (or safe, for that matter!).

Being aware of these conditions isn’t just smart; it’s essential. Before you take off, make sure you have a solid understanding of the forecast. Clear skies may indicate a perfect opportunity for capturing stunning visuals, while stormy weather should have you firmly grounded.
